Preparation time varies by product: some chickpea rice options are ready in under 4 minutes, while heat‑and‑serve pouches can be ready in about 90 seconds.
Shoppers commonly describe the flavor as consistently tasty and pronounced. Texture is often compared to orzo rather than traditional rice, and it can become mushy if overcooked or prepared improperly.
Typical net weights are around 7–8 ounces; examples in listings include 7 oz, 7.05 oz, and 8 oz packages.
Chickpeas are the main ingredient; some blends also include multiple whole grains such as quinoa and chia seeds—examples include formulations described as a 9‑grain mix.
Chickpea rice is sold both as products that require full cooking and as prepared heat‑and‑serve pouches. You’ll find quick‑cook formats and ready‑to‑heat/heat‑and‑serve options.
